Innovations in Robotics



One major development in dental surgery is making use of robotic innovation, which enables exact and effective surgeries. With the help of robot systems, dental specialists have the capacity to carry out complex surgical procedures with enhanced accuracy, reducing the risk of human mistake.



These robot systems are outfitted with sophisticated imaging technology and exact instruments that make it possible for cosmetic surgeons to navigate through detailed anatomical structures with ease. By utilizing robotic technology, cosmetic surgeons can attain higher medical precision, resulting in enhanced client results and faster healing times.

On top of that, making use of robotics in oral surgery permits minimally intrusive procedures, minimizing the trauma to bordering tissues and promoting faster recovery.

3D Printing in Oral Surgery



To improve the area of dental surgery, you can explore the subtopic of 3D printing in dental surgery. This ingenious technology has the prospective to transform the way dental doctors operate and deal with individuals. Right here are four key methods which 3D printing is shaping the area:

- ** Customized Surgical Guides **: 3D printing allows for the development of very exact and patient-specific medical overviews, boosting the accuracy and efficiency of treatments.

-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, minimizing the requirement for conventional grafting methods and boosting healing and recovery time.

- ** Education and Educating **: 3D printing can be utilized to create reasonable medical models for academic functions, permitting oral cosmetic surgeons to practice intricate procedures prior to performing them on patients.

With its prospective to enhance accuracy, modification, and training, 3D printing is an amazing development in the field of dental surgery.

Minimally Intrusive Methods



To further progress the field of oral surgery, accept the capacity of minimally invasive methods that can substantially benefit both doctors and people alike.

Minimally intrusive strategies are revolutionizing the field by lowering medical trauma, reducing post-operative discomfort, and accelerating the recuperation procedure. These methods involve utilizing smaller sized incisions and specialized tools to perform treatments with accuracy and effectiveness.

By using innovative imaging innovation, such as cone beam calculated tomography (CBCT), specialists can properly intend and implement surgical procedures with minimal invasiveness.

In addition, using lasers in dental surgery allows for specific tissue cutting and coagulation, causing minimized blood loss and reduced healing time.

With minimally invasive strategies, individuals can experience much faster healing, reduced scarring, and improved end results, making it a necessary element of the future of oral surgery.
